TBS to Launch "Angie Tribeca" with 25-Hour Marathon of the Entire First Season Commercial-Free Starting Jan. 17; Orders 10 More Seasons Prior to Series Premiere in Largest Renewal Ever

Weekly Rollout of Seasons 2-11 Begin Monday, Jan. 25

Rashida Jones, Hayes MacArthur, Jere Burns, Deon Cole and Andree Vermeulen Star in TBS's Powerful, Heroic, Unforgettable and Tastefully Erotic Cop Show

TBS has already renewed its upcoming series Angie Tribeca for 10 all-new seasons well before the curtain even rises on the future Emmy(R) winner. TBS will introduce viewers to its first-ever police procedural with a massive, international multiplatform launch on Sunday, Jan. 17, giving subscribers the opportunity to binge on all 10 episodes of season 1 commercial-free through a 25-hour on-air marathon (Sunday 9 p.m. - Monday 10 p.m. ET/PT), as well as through TBS's VOD, digital and mobile platforms. Then on Monday, Jan. 25, TBS will begin rolling out season 2-11, each of which consists of one episode, giving viewers a season premiere and season finale in one really tight package. The new seasons will launch weekly across TBS platforms each Monday at 9:30 p.m. (ET/P T).

Real, brooding and shockingly alive, Angie Tribeca is the brainchild of Steve and Nancy Carell, who executive-produce the series through their Carousel Television. The series follows a squad of committed LAPD detectives who investigate the most serious cases, from the murder of a ventriloquist to a rash of baker suicides.

At the center of Angie Tribeca is Angie Tribeca, played by Rashida Jones (The Office, Parks and Recreation) in the performance of a lifetime as a lone-wolf detective who is none too happy when partnered with J Geils, played by Hayes MacArthur (Life As We Know It, Go On). Jere Burns (Justified, Breaking Bad) plays the squad's apoplectic captain. Helping solve each complex case are detective Danny Tanner, played by Deon Cole (CONAN, Black-ish); Dr. Monica Scholls, the quirky, bespectacled medical examiner played by Andrée Vermeulen (Upright Citizen's Brigade, How To Train Your Dragon television series); and Hoffman, Tanner's K9 German Shepard partner played by Jagger ( Max). Not involved with the series is Martin Scorsese (Raging Bull, Goodfellas).

"Angie Tribeca has everything anyone could ever imagine in a crime drama," said a TBS spokesperson, speaking on condition of anonymity. "Dead bodies, heinous crimes, complex mysteries within mysteries, violence, grit, sex, gritty sex and a detective who will stop at nothing to get her man... or woman... or ferret. We are so incredibly proud of Angie Tribeca, we're going to shove it down America's throat in a really big way. And not just America. We're taking Angie global!"

On the international front, TBS's throat-shoving strategy for Angie Tribeca involves rolling out the show on numerous Turner International entertainment networks in January. Turner's Latin American and German networks are set to join the 25-hour marathon on Jan. 17, while Spanish, Nordic and Asian networks (both truTV and Warner TV) will premiere all first-season episodes at one time.

Angie Tribeca: The Launch

Season 1 - Starting Sunday, Jan. 17

Binge watching is the new normal, but for such a haunting, raw series like Angie Tribeca, one binge won't be enough. So TBS is going to give viewers the ultimate binge experience: a 25-hour marathon of the entire season played five times in a row, Sunday, Jan. 17, at 9 p.m. (ET/PT) - Monday, Jan. 18, at 10 p.m. (ET/PT), with each episode running commercial-free. The first season will also be available across TBS On Demand, tbs.com, the Watch TBS mobile app and participating providers' platforms and apps. It's the biggest epic event since TV's last big epic event.

Seasons 2-11 - Available Mondays, beginning Jan. 25

After binging on Angie Tribeca's first season, viewers can start diving into seasons 2-11, each one consisting of a single episode that will allow viewers to experience the emotional highs of a season premiere and season finale in one powerful 30-minute package. Seasons 2-11 of Angie Tribeca are set to debut Mondays at 9:30 p.m. (ET/PT), starting Jan. 25, followed by availability across TBS's on-demand platforms. As if that weren't enough, each week's season premiere/finale on the linear network will be followed by an encore telecast from season 1 at 10 p.m. (ET/PT).
